Transaction 2ec666df352e8423f3eb5c0094edefc4d8d28ad4c7d736a57ff1b192863e0217

1 Input
2 Outputs
  • 2ec666df352e8423f3eb5c0094edefc4d8d28ad4c7d736a57ff1b192863e0217:0
  • value  18830
    address  188aPb63PZvhhGJR9M4x1gjT2dV1XuLNej
  • 2ec666df352e8423f3eb5c0094edefc4d8d28ad4c7d736a57ff1b192863e0217:1
  • value  10825877
    address  17sdv5ByS12wAxgPJTfKHNo8bkuS5v48id